产品介绍 | background: HGS is a regulates endosomal sorting and plays a critical role in the recycling and degradation of membrane receptors. The encoded protein sorts monoubiquitinated membrane proteins into the multivesicular body, targeting these proteins for lysosome-dependent degradation. [provided by RefSeq, Dec 2010]. Function: Involved in intracellular signal transduction mediated by cytokines and growth factors. When associated with STAM, it suppresses DNA signaling upon stimulation by IL-2 and GM-CSF. Could be a direct effector of PI3-kinase in vesicular pathway via early endosomes and may regulate trafficking to early and late endosomes by recruiting clathrin. May concentrate ubiquitinated receptors within clathrin-coated regions. Involved in down-regulation of receptor tyrosine kinase via multivesicular body (MVBs) when complexed with STAM (ESCRT-0 complex). The ESCRT-0 complex binds ubiquitin and acts as sorting machinery that recognizes ubiquitinated receptors and transfers them to further sequential lysosomal sorting/trafficking processes. May contribute to the efficient recruitment of SMADs to the activin receptor complex. Involved in receptor recycling via its association with the CART complex, a multiprotein complex required for efficient transferrin receptor recycling but not for EGFR degradation. Subcellular Location: Cytoplasm. Early endosome membrane. Endosome,multivesicular body membrane. Tissue Specificity: Ubiquitous expression in adult and fetal tissues with higher expression in testis and peripheral blood leukocytes. Post-translational modifications: Phosphorylated on Tyr-334. A minor site of phosphorylation on Tyr-329 is detected. Phosphorylation occurs in response to EGF, IL-2, GM-CSF and HGF. Ubiquitinated by ITCH. Similarity: Contains 1 FYVE-type zinc finger. Contains 1 UIM (ubiquitin-interacting motif) repeat. Contains 1 VHS domain.
